将需要重复使用的值存放在属性中,在需要的地方直接使用属性名。
<project> ...
<properties>
<spring.version>2.5.6<spring.version>
</properties>
<dependencies> <dependency> <groupId>org.springframework</groupId> <artifactId>spring-core</artifactId> <version>${spring.version}</version>
</dependency> ...
</dependencies> ...</project>
您还没有登录,请您登录后再发表评论
4. **插件管理**:通过`<build><plugins>`定义项目构建过程中使用的Maven插件及其配置。 5. **属性与继承**:`pom.xml`支持属性(`<properties>`)和继承(`<parent>`),使得多个项目可以共享相同的配置。 `...
该jar包功能,可以在一个properties文件里面定义jdbc.url=${url},在另一个properties文件定义具体的值,通过该jar可以获取到哪个具体的值。下载之后,自行安装到本地...具体pom.xml配置使用可以参考网络其他博文,谢谢
Maven使用POM来驱动构建过程,通过解析POM中的信息,执行编译、测试、打包、部署等一系列任务。正确配置POM是确保Maven项目能正确构建和依赖管理的关键。每个Maven项目都应有一个完整的POM,以便Maven能够理解项目的...
- `build/plugins`: 配置构建过程中使用的Maven插件,包括`groupId`, `artifactId`, `version`,以及插件的目标(goals)和配置参数。 - `build/pluginManagement`: 类似于`dependencyManagement`,提供插件版本和...
`packaging`属性定义了项目产生的构件类型,常见的有`jar`、`war`、`ear`等。Maven通过这一属性决定构建过程的输出类型,从而适应不同类型的项目需求。 ### 元数据(Metadata) - **name**: 项目名称,用于Maven生成...
在Java开发领域,Maven是一个不可或缺的项目管理工具,它通过使用一个名为pom.xml的配置文件来管理和构建项目。pom.xml文件是Maven项目的灵魂,它包含了项目的元数据,如项目信息、依赖关系、构建配置等。下面我们将...
这些属性可以在整个POM中使用,也可以作为触发条件。 pom.xml文件是Maven项目的核心配置文件,它规定了项目的依赖关系、编译环境、测试环境、打包方式等信息。通过理解和配置这些元素,我们可以更好地管理和维护...
5. **属性**:可以定义项目中的变量,便于在整个`pom.xml`文件中复用。 6. **父POM**:如果项目继承自其他父项目,可以引用父POM,从而继承其配置。 7. **模块**:多模块项目中,可以声明子模块,使得整个项目结构...
本主题将深入探讨如何在Maven的配置文件`pom.xml`中添加Oracle数据库驱动(jar)以实现与Oracle数据库的连接。首先,我们需要理解`pom.xml`文件的作用,它是Maven项目的元数据文件,包含了项目的信息、构建指令以及...
你可以根据不同的环境值来调整这些属性,然后在配置文件或代码中使用`${env}`来引用。 2. **文件夹方式**:创建不同环境的配置文件夹,如`src/main/resources-dev`、`src/main/resources-test`和`src/main/...
标题中的“pom.zip_java maven_pom mainfest java_pom manifest 标签_pom 文件 mani”暗示了我们讨论的主题是Maven项目中的`pom.xml`文件与Manifest文件的关联。Manifest文件在Java应用程序和库中用于记录元数据,如...
在批处理文件中使用`mvn`命令下载`pom.xml`中的jar包,通常会包含以下步骤: 1. 配置Maven:批处理文件可能会引用一个名为`settings.xml`的配置文件,这个文件位于`~/.m2/`目录下(对于Windows用户通常是 `%USER...
### Maven中整合Spring与Hibernate的Pom.xml配置详解 在Java Web开发中,Spring框架以其强大的功能和灵活性被广泛应用于企业级应用的构建之中。而Hibernate作为一种流行的对象关系映射(ORM)工具,能有效简化...
首先,在pom文件中,我们需要添加两个属性,一个是用于保存Maven编译时间戳的`maven.build.timestamp`,另一个是用于指定时间格式的`maven.build.timestamp.format`。这两个属性是我们获取Maven-pom中的版本号和编译...
这篇博文主要讨论了`pom.xml`文件中的常用配置,以帮助开发者更好地理解和使用Maven。 首先,`<project>`是`pom.xml`的根元素,它包含了关于项目的所有信息。其中,`<modelVersion>`定义了pom模型的版本,通常是...
当子项目中没有定义某个元素时,Maven会查找父POM中的相应配置作为默认值。这种继承机制简化了大型项目中重复配置的管理。 此外,POM文件还可以包含以下重要元素: - `dependencies`:定义项目依赖的库,每个`...
3. **配置pom.xml**: `pom.xml`是Maven项目的配置文件,我们需要在这里定义项目的属性、依赖、构建过程等。对于Flex项目,需要添加`maven-flex-plugin`或`com.adobe.flexmojos:flexmojos-maven-plugin`,并指定Flex ...
7. **属性(Properties)**:定义可重用的项目属性,方便在整个`pom.xml`中引用。 ```xml <java.version>1.8 ``` 8. **依赖管理(Dependency Management)**:用于统一管理项目的依赖版本。 9. **分布配置...
1. **Maven配置**:项目根目录下的pom.xml文件是Maven的核心,它定义了项目的属性、依赖、构建过程等。在这个配置文件中,你需要声明SpringMVC和MyBatis的依赖,以及其他必要的库,比如Servlet API、JSP等。 2. **...
相关推荐
4. **插件管理**:通过`<build><plugins>`定义项目构建过程中使用的Maven插件及其配置。 5. **属性与继承**:`pom.xml`支持属性(`<properties>`)和继承(`<parent>`),使得多个项目可以共享相同的配置。 `...
该jar包功能,可以在一个properties文件里面定义jdbc.url=${url},在另一个properties文件定义具体的值,通过该jar可以获取到哪个具体的值。下载之后,自行安装到本地...具体pom.xml配置使用可以参考网络其他博文,谢谢
Maven使用POM来驱动构建过程,通过解析POM中的信息,执行编译、测试、打包、部署等一系列任务。正确配置POM是确保Maven项目能正确构建和依赖管理的关键。每个Maven项目都应有一个完整的POM,以便Maven能够理解项目的...
- `build/plugins`: 配置构建过程中使用的Maven插件,包括`groupId`, `artifactId`, `version`,以及插件的目标(goals)和配置参数。 - `build/pluginManagement`: 类似于`dependencyManagement`,提供插件版本和...
`packaging`属性定义了项目产生的构件类型,常见的有`jar`、`war`、`ear`等。Maven通过这一属性决定构建过程的输出类型,从而适应不同类型的项目需求。 ### 元数据(Metadata) - **name**: 项目名称,用于Maven生成...
在Java开发领域,Maven是一个不可或缺的项目管理工具,它通过使用一个名为pom.xml的配置文件来管理和构建项目。pom.xml文件是Maven项目的灵魂,它包含了项目的元数据,如项目信息、依赖关系、构建配置等。下面我们将...
这些属性可以在整个POM中使用,也可以作为触发条件。 pom.xml文件是Maven项目的核心配置文件,它规定了项目的依赖关系、编译环境、测试环境、打包方式等信息。通过理解和配置这些元素,我们可以更好地管理和维护...
5. **属性**:可以定义项目中的变量,便于在整个`pom.xml`文件中复用。 6. **父POM**:如果项目继承自其他父项目,可以引用父POM,从而继承其配置。 7. **模块**:多模块项目中,可以声明子模块,使得整个项目结构...
本主题将深入探讨如何在Maven的配置文件`pom.xml`中添加Oracle数据库驱动(jar)以实现与Oracle数据库的连接。首先,我们需要理解`pom.xml`文件的作用,它是Maven项目的元数据文件,包含了项目的信息、构建指令以及...
你可以根据不同的环境值来调整这些属性,然后在配置文件或代码中使用`${env}`来引用。 2. **文件夹方式**:创建不同环境的配置文件夹,如`src/main/resources-dev`、`src/main/resources-test`和`src/main/...
标题中的“pom.zip_java maven_pom mainfest java_pom manifest 标签_pom 文件 mani”暗示了我们讨论的主题是Maven项目中的`pom.xml`文件与Manifest文件的关联。Manifest文件在Java应用程序和库中用于记录元数据,如...
在批处理文件中使用`mvn`命令下载`pom.xml`中的jar包,通常会包含以下步骤: 1. 配置Maven:批处理文件可能会引用一个名为`settings.xml`的配置文件,这个文件位于`~/.m2/`目录下(对于Windows用户通常是 `%USER...
### Maven中整合Spring与Hibernate的Pom.xml配置详解 在Java Web开发中,Spring框架以其强大的功能和灵活性被广泛应用于企业级应用的构建之中。而Hibernate作为一种流行的对象关系映射(ORM)工具,能有效简化...
首先,在pom文件中,我们需要添加两个属性,一个是用于保存Maven编译时间戳的`maven.build.timestamp`,另一个是用于指定时间格式的`maven.build.timestamp.format`。这两个属性是我们获取Maven-pom中的版本号和编译...
这篇博文主要讨论了`pom.xml`文件中的常用配置,以帮助开发者更好地理解和使用Maven。 首先,`<project>`是`pom.xml`的根元素,它包含了关于项目的所有信息。其中,`<modelVersion>`定义了pom模型的版本,通常是...
当子项目中没有定义某个元素时,Maven会查找父POM中的相应配置作为默认值。这种继承机制简化了大型项目中重复配置的管理。 此外,POM文件还可以包含以下重要元素: - `dependencies`:定义项目依赖的库,每个`...
3. **配置pom.xml**: `pom.xml`是Maven项目的配置文件,我们需要在这里定义项目的属性、依赖、构建过程等。对于Flex项目,需要添加`maven-flex-plugin`或`com.adobe.flexmojos:flexmojos-maven-plugin`,并指定Flex ...
7. **属性(Properties)**:定义可重用的项目属性,方便在整个`pom.xml`中引用。 ```xml <java.version>1.8 ``` 8. **依赖管理(Dependency Management)**:用于统一管理项目的依赖版本。 9. **分布配置...
1. **Maven配置**:项目根目录下的pom.xml文件是Maven的核心,它定义了项目的属性、依赖、构建过程等。在这个配置文件中,你需要声明SpringMVC和MyBatis的依赖,以及其他必要的库,比如Servlet API、JSP等。 2. **...